AI-Driven Bug Hunting Forces Chrome into Twice-Weekly Patching - What Enterprises Must Do

AI-assisted vulnerability discovery has accelerated the identification of Chrome bugs, prompting Google to increase patch frequency. Organizations running Chrome at scale need to treat more frequent updates as the new normal and strengthen patching, mitigation, and monitoring practices to reduce exposure windows.

Trend and technical drivers. AI tools are enabling researchers and attackers alike to find software vulnerabilities faster than traditional methods. Google's response - more frequent Chrome updates and emergency patches - reflects a broader industry shift: vulnerability discovery velocity has increased, and vendors are compelled to ship fixes at higher cadence to keep pace with exploit risk.

Business and security impact. Faster patch cycles increase operational overhead for IT and security teams. Enterprises with strict change-control processes, regulated environments, or legacy systems may struggle to deploy frequent browser patches without disrupting workflows. Unpatched browsers become high-risk endpoints, especially given Chrome's ubiquity in enterprise environments and its role as an attack vector for web-based exploits.

Mitigations and resilience measures. Treat browser patching like critical infrastructure: automate update distribution through enterprise management tools, implement phased rollouts with telemetry, and maintain compensating controls such as endpoint detection and response, network segmentation, and web isolation for high-risk users. Where immediate patching is infeasible, use temporary mitigations - policy restrictions, plugin whitelists, or sandboxing - and monitor vendor advisories closely.

Recommended leader actions. Reevaluate change-control policies to allow emergency security patching, invest in tooling for centralized patch orchestration and telemetry, and align security operations with business continuity teams to minimize disruption. Incorporate accelerated vulnerability discovery into risk assessments and tabletop exercises, and budget for higher operational tempo - staffing, automation, and third-party services - to maintain security posture in an era of AI-accelerated vulnerability discovery.
